How to Do a Random Sample in Excel
Creating a random sample in Excel is a quick and effective way to analyze a subset of your data without dealing with the entire dataset. To achieve this, you’ll use Excel’s built-in functions to generate random numbers and sort your data accordingly. Here’s a step-by-step guide to help you through the process.
Step-by-Step Tutorial on How to Do a Random Sample in Excel
This tutorial will walk you through the steps to select a random sample from your data in Excel. By the end, you’ll have a randomized subset of your data ready for analysis.
Step 1: Open Your Excel File
First, open your Excel file that contains the dataset.
Having your dataset open allows you to work directly with the data you want to analyze.
Step 2: Insert a New Column
Add a new column next to your data. Label this column "Random" or something similar.
This new column will be used to generate random numbers for each row in your dataset.
Step 3: Generate Random Numbers
In the first cell of the new column, type =RAND()
. Press Enter and then copy this formula down through all the rows of your data.
The =RAND()
function generates a random number between 0 and 1 for each row, creating the basis for your random sample.
Step 4: Copy and Paste Values
Select the entire column with the random numbers, copy it, and then paste it as values.
Pasting as values ensures that the random numbers don’t change every time Excel recalculates.
Step 5: Sort by Random Numbers
Highlight your entire dataset, including the new column, and sort it by the "Random" column.
Sorting your data by the random numbers will shuffle your dataset, effectively creating a random order.
Step 6: Select Your Sample
Choose the top ‘n’ number of rows from your sorted data to form your random sample.
For example, if you need a sample size of 100, select the first 100 rows from the sorted data.
After following these steps, you’ll have a randomized subset of your data.
Tips for How to Do a Random Sample in Excel
- Backup Your Data: Always make a copy of your original dataset before making changes.
- Consistent Sampling: Use the same random seed if you need to repeat the procedure for consistency.
- Check for Duplicates: Ensure your random sample doesn’t have unwanted duplicates by using the
Remove Duplicates
feature. - Scalable Method: This method works for datasets of any size, from a few rows to thousands.
- Recalculate Random Numbers: If needed, press
F9
to generate new random numbers without changing your dataset.
Frequently Asked Questions
What is the purpose of generating random samples?
Random samples are used to analyze a subset of data, making it easier to detect patterns and make predictions without processing the entire dataset.
Can I use this method for large datasets?
Yes, Excel handles large datasets efficiently, although the number of rows may be limited by your computer’s memory.
Does this method work on Excel Online?
Yes, the steps are similar, but the interface might differ slightly. Always ensure your formulas and sorting options are correct.
Can I automate this process?
Yes, you can use Excel macros to automate the process of generating random samples.
What if my dataset includes non-numeric data?
No problem. The random number generation and sorting methods work regardless of whether your data is numeric or non-numeric.
Summary
- Open your Excel file.
- Insert a new column.
- Generate random numbers.
- Copy and paste values.
- Sort by random numbers.
- Select your sample.
Conclusion
Creating a random sample in Excel is straightforward and incredibly useful for data analysis. By following these steps, you can easily randomize your dataset and focus on a subset for more detailed analysis. This method not only saves time but also ensures that your sample is truly random, which is crucial for accurate results.
If you’re working with large datasets or need to repeat this process regularly, consider learning about Excel macros to automate the steps. Additionally, always backup your data and double-check for any duplicates to maintain the integrity of your sample.
Whether you’re a student working on a project, a researcher conducting a study, or a business analyst diving into data, mastering the art of random sampling in Excel is a valuable skill. So, dive in and start experimenting with your data today!
Matt Jacobs has been working as an IT consultant for small businesses since receiving his Master’s degree in 2003. While he still does some consulting work, his primary focus now is on creating technology support content for SupportYourTech.com.
His work can be found on many websites and focuses on topics such as Microsoft Office, Apple devices, Android devices, Photoshop, and more.